Responsible Gaming

Gaming Should Be Fun, Not a Financial Solution

At nzfisher.co.nz, we're committed to promoting responsible gaming practices. Spin Casino NZ should be enjoyed as entertainment only—never as a way to earn money or solve financial problems. The house always has a mathematical edge, and the outcome of every spin is determined by chance.

If you choose to play, set a budget you can afford to lose and stick to it. Remember: gambling carries real financial risk.

Age Verification

Online gambling in New Zealand is only available to players aged 18 years and over. By accessing Spin Casino NZ, you confirm that you meet the legal age requirement in your jurisdiction and that gambling is permitted where you reside.

If you are under 18, please do not participate in online gambling. Underage gambling can cause serious harm to your development and financial wellbeing.
